botolo
bo-TO-lo
undress
French: déshabiller / enlever (un vêtement)
Botolo elamba na yo.
Take off your clothes.
Enlève tes vêtements.
Undress — taking the cloth off, gently or in a hurry. Botolo (with elamba, cloth) is to undress, from kobotola, to take away. A mother botolo a child before the bath; the same root, alone, can mean to seize — context tells which.
